Transaction 58efa81c0ca478e910759463efc3cc27817b54b3dbd8002e4fbbde1898c08668
1 Input
1 Output
-
58efa81c0ca478e910759463efc3cc27817b54b3dbd8002e4fbbde1898c08668:0
- value
- 5493636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 123501fde01a2ac36413bb11c1489a8a69ff020d OP_EQUAL
- address
- 33MHb3Ny6hMae2XjW16x87fw2KFxM5ya2Z